How to get there

Plane

The best way to get to Kassel, Germany by plane is to fly to Frankfurt Airport and then take a train from Frankfurt Flughafen Fernbahnhof station to Kassel-Wilhelmshöhe station. From there, take a bus or taxi to your final destination in Kassel.

Car

The best way to get to Kassel, Germany by car is to take the A7 motorway from Frankfurt to Kassel. The journey takes around 2 hours, depending on traffic.

Train

The best way to get to Kassel, Germany by train is to take a high-speed ICE train from Frankfurt Hauptbahnhof station to Kassel-Wilhelmshöhe station. From there, take a bus or taxi to your final destination in Kassel.

Boat

There is no direct way to get to Kassel, Germany by boat as the city is not located on any major waterways. However, it is possible to take a river cruise to nearby cities such as Hann. Münden and then take a train or bus to Kassel.

Bus

The best way to get to Kassel, Germany by bus is to take a Flixbus from Frankfurt Airport or Frankfurt Central Station to Kassel. The journey takes around 3 hours.
